Supervisors Analog Devices, Inc. MAX6833FXRD3 Overview

The MAX6833FXRD3 by Analog Devices, Inc. is a high-performance supervisor IC designed for precise voltage monitoring. Tailored to ensure system integrity, this component excels in managing power supplies by monitoring and controlling the voltage levels within critical applications. As part of the Supervisors category, this IC guarantees reliable operation by providing a robust supervisory solution that prevents system failures due to unstable or inadequate power supply. The use of this supervisor IC in your designs can significantly enhance system reliability and performance, making it an essential component for developers and engineers aiming to improve their electronic products. Its compact SC703 package allows for integration in space-constrained applications while maintaining high functionality and performance.

MAX6833FXRD3 Features

The MAX6833FXRD3 features include a single monitoring channel which is critical for simpler system designs that require only one point of voltage supervision. Its low power consumption and small form factor make it ideal for portable applications. The device is also characterized by its ability to reset microcontrollers through a reset output upon detecting voltages that are out of predefined thresholds, thereby safeguarding system components and data integrity.
